Goody’s agent, Max Clifford, made the announcement a short time ago after receiving the confirmation from the 27-year-old’s mother, Jackiey Budden.
“It’s just very sad,” Clifford said, on the verge of tears. “We got very close and I’ve got a lot of respect and admiration for the girl. She was a 27-year-old girl facing up to cervical cancer.”
Clifford received a phone call from Budden shortly after 3 a.m. this morning, who told him: “My beautiful girl has gone.”
Ironically, Goody passed away in the early hours of Sunday morning - Mother’s Day in Great Britain - after agreeing to live the last weeks of her life in the public eye to give her sons the best possible chance at a future free from financial struggle.
The controversial reality television star first learned that she had cancer whilst competing in the Indian version of Big Brother.
